Output eca109aad276cad99e8c9fe1c664a6362c94718332b36ebfdcb923bf3f2606b6:0

value
78772943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d5380d004066a93a43ca38e14f552754a1ff32 OP_EQUAL
address
MSaDWGxCbLUfsH7d5vn4t5Pf1EfwN2EkLp
transaction
eca109aad276cad99e8c9fe1c664a6362c94718332b36ebfdcb923bf3f2606b6
spent
true